Scripting es
una de las áreas más importantes en el desarrollo
de Siebel, pero la ironía es que no se
recomienda escribir un script en Siebel. Siebel scripting esta
hecho en un lenguaje conocido como eScript. eScript comparte su
sintaxis con JavaScript. Si alguna vez has
trabajado en JavaScript, entonces te resultaría fácil
adaptarte a eScript.
eScript
puede clasificarse en dos
categorías:
* Scripts del servidor
* Scripts del navegador
Scripts del servidor: Se refiere a la solicitud enviada por el usuario la cual posteriormente, se envía al servidor en el que son ejecutadas las secuencias de comandos.
* Scripts del servidor
* Scripts del navegador
Scripts del servidor: Se refiere a la solicitud enviada por el usuario la cual posteriormente, se envía al servidor en el que son ejecutadas las secuencias de comandos.
Scripts
del navegador: Se convierte
en JavaScript y se ejecuta en el lado del
cliente.
Por
lo general, las secuencias de
comandos escriben en los objetos
de Siebel tales como Applets, Business component,
etc. Sin embargo, el uso principal de eScript se
hace para escribir Business Services. Hay un montón
de cosas que debemos lograr a través de un Business
Service. Pero es similar a la implementación de los
procesos de negocios workflows con la ayuda de un script.
Se
debe utilizar las secuencias de comandos como
último recurso. Todo se puede hacer a través de scripts,
esto hace el manejo y la gestión de la aplicación un poco más
difícil.
Pero,
como les dije en mi post anterior para ser
un desarrollador Siebel es fundamental haber trabajado
anteriormente con las secuencias de comandos y tener
conocimientos en la configuración, la cual debe ser
su punto fuerte. Las secuencias de
comandos pueden llegar a ser divertidas, pero debes tratar de
evitarlas siempre y cuando sea posible.
J.
Aquino